faxll

The faxll program uses the low-level non-infopkt raw data fax

sending and receiving routines to send or receive facsimiles. This

application uses the BfvFaxSendFile function, so 128-byte

Brooktrout headers are not permitted. It also uses the user function

feature of BfvLineOriginateCall to print call progress values.

Use the -g or -a argument to specify that the next raw data file

contains G3 or ASCII data, respectively. If a file contains fine

resolution data, use the -F argument. Use the -b argument to

specify a page break.

Turn on the Bfv API debug program from the command line. The

btcall.cfg file is the user configuration file. The faxll program is

found in the app.src directory.
